Mumias East Member of Parliament (MP) Peter Salasya has said the spirit of Baba (Raila Odinga) will one day make Oketch Salah go mad and reveal the truth about what happened.

In a statement on Wednesday, January 28, 2026, he claimed that Baba was a spirit and that the conversations Salah is leading are guiding the spirit toward the truth. Salasya insists that Winnie Odinga and Junior are the true DNA of Baba and cannot betray him.

He says, “The spirit of Baba one day will make Oketch Salah go mad and spill the beans on what exactly happened.”

Salasya adds that he likes the direction Salah is taking because it allows the spirit of Baba to continue leading them to the truth.

According to Salasya, the family bloodline is strong and loyal.

“One thing I know, Winnie and Junior are the true DNA of Baba and can’t betray him,” he says.

He believes the spirit of Baba is actively influencing events and that the truth will eventually be revealed through Salah.

Oketch Salah and the truth

Speaking exclusively to a local TV station on Tuesday, January 27, 2026, Winnie Odinga addressed recent claims about her father, the late former prime minister Raila Odinga. She said Oketch Salah was not present when her father died and dismissed his recent statements as false and dangerous.

Winnie directly said, “I have met Oketch Salah, but I’d like to believe nobody really knows him. A flat-out lie that you were there at the time of my father’s death and you were not, and talking about things that did not occur, is quite dangerous and makes me question his intentions.”

Oketch Salah identifies himself as Raila Odinga’s adopted son. He has made claims about being present at the late Baba’s passing, but Winnie says this is untrue. She stresses that these statements create confusion and are not based on facts.

Her remarks come days after Oketch Salah, an influential figure within ODM, published an emotional tribute in which he described his relationship with the late Raila Odinga.

Salasya continues to defend the role of ‘Baba’s spirit’ in revealing the truth. He says the spirit will guide the right people and eventually expose events that some may wish to hide.
